Conferences List

If you are logged in as a user with Operator or Administrator
permissions:
The Conferences pane lists all the conferences currently running on the
MCU along with their Status, Conference ID, Start Time and End Time data.
The number of ongoing conferences is displayed in the pane's title.

The Conferences list toolbar contains the following buttons:
New Conference – to start a new ongoing conference.
Delete Conference – delete the selected conference(s).
If Conference Recording is enabled the following are displayed in color:
— Start/Resume Recording – start/resume recording.
In MPMx mode, a Recording Indication is displayed to all
conference participants informing them that the conference is
being recorded.
— Stop Recording – stop recording.
— Pause –
In MPMx mode, a Paused Indication is displayed to all conference
participants informing them that conference recording has been
paused.
If you are logged in as a user with Chairperson permissions:
You can list and monitor conferences you have started or for which
you have entered the password or that don't have a Chairperson
Password assigned.
A Chairperson Password field and a Refresh button are displayed.
The Refresh button does not change the Chairperson Password; it
refreshes the Conferences list to display all ongoing conferences with
the requested password.
